Zodiac

 American true crime mystery movie “Zodiac” (2007) directed by David Fincher and starring Jake Gyllenhaal, Mark Ruffalo, Robert Downey Jr. among others.

Its based on a true crimes committed by one Zodiac who left ciphers and sent letters to the San Francisco Chronicle. Jake Gyllenhaal is a cartoonist in the SFC and Robert Downey Jr. a reporter in the same newspaper.

Mark Ruffalo is handling the case but they get no clues. They interview one Arthur Leigh Allen and all clues point to him as the possible Zodiac. But the handwriting match turns negative and the case is lost.

Robert Graysmith (Jake Gyllenhaal) pursues the case doggedly though he is only a cartoonist and not a police man. He is interested in the cipher code and does a lot of leg work which points him to Arthur Leigh Allen.

Mike Mageau who is the survivor from the first shooting of the couple in 1969 identifies Allen as the man who shot him. But by the time they start investigation, Allen dies of a heart attack.

So officially this case remains unsolved in America’s crime history. A rather longish movie which painstakingly takes the viewers through the happenings from 1969 onwards to more than 25 years later. A lot of detailing has gone into the script.

Of the actors, both Jake Gyllenhaal and Mark Ruffalo have done good roles as required of them. IMDB 5/10

Iratta

 Deadly Malayalam crime thriller movie “Iratta” (2023), directed by Rohit M.G. Krishnan and starring Joju George, Anjali, Arya Salim among others.

Its a story of twin brothers Pramod and Vinod (both played by Joju George) and their respective flashback stories. Both were inseparable in childhood, but had to be separated because of their abusive and womanising father.

Vinod had to stay with his father while Pramod went to his mother. Both enter the police and again both have back stories. Vinod is single until he meets Malini (Anjali) who is subjected to beatings by her husband, a pastor.

Pramod had a wife and daughter, but due to alcoholic ways, his wife separated from him for 17 years. Too much of flashbacks take place. Anyways, one fine evening, Vinod is found shot dead in the police station.

There are lots of suspects and investigations and police procedures, to’s and fro’s going on. Vinod is given to gambling and drinking and in one such binge, he comes across a teenaged girl in a lodge and rapes her.

Meanwhile Pramod’s daughter grows up in Mumbai with her mother and she enters the singing contest on live T.V. The ending is quite gut wrenching as Pramod has to deal with some uncertain truths, just when his wife was beginning to reconcile with him.

Joju George has done an absolutely astounding role as the drunken, brazen, cop in two avatars giving it all it requires to deal with the frustrations, despair and sadness. Watch the movie for his acting only. Its breathtaking.

Otherwise the overall script is okay, camera work and cinematography are all good and background music is superb. Rohit M.G. Krishnan has managed to etch a taut crime thriller on the screen with suspense towards the end. IMDB 5/10

The Dove's Lost Necklace

 


The second part of Nacer Khemir’s desert trilogy “The Dove’s Lost Necklace” (1994), a Tunisian film starring Navin Chowdhry, Walid Arakji, Nina Esber among others.

Hassan (Navin Chowdhry) is learning Arabic calligraphy and on a quest for true love. He is learning the 60 words for love prescribed in Arabic literature and has so far found 35 of them.

Zin (Walid Arakji) is a young kid who is a son of a djinn but everybody calls him a bastard. He delivers love messages for money and so that Prince Haroun, the prince trapped in a monkey becomes real again.

They find a half burnt manuscript which reveals of a lament of Princess Samarkhand. Hassan is looking for that book which talks about true love but the store room in which they look for the book is burnt down.

He finally finds Aziz (Nina Esber) the beautiful Princess of Samarkand and then loses her. Nacer Khemir has created a magnificent and enchanting story rich in metaphor and with a visual imagery stunning for all its beauty. The camera work and cinematography capturing the Arabian architecture and landscape is breathtaking. The rich Arabian music enriches the story to perfection.

Walid Arakji is a stunner of an actor, a young child, with a naughty smile and lots of energy. Navin Chowdhry has done a good role but it is Nina Esber who captures the screen presence with her ravisihing good looks and beauty. IMDB 6/10

Wanderers of the Desert

 


First part of a three part Desert trilogy “Wanderers of the Desert”, a Tunisian film by writer/ director Nacer Khemir and starring Nacer Khemir, Souflane Makni, Noureddine Kasbaoui, Hedi Daoud and Sonia Ichti among others.

A young teacher arrives in a remote village of which many have not heard of. When he arrives, the villagers welcome him, but there is no school building.

The teacher is told that the young men of the village go around wandering in the desert like a ghost due to a curse. Once a year the wanderers come back and the teacher is given a book which he has to make them read so that the curse will be broken.

There is lot of mystery and mystique in the story. A young kid breaks all the mirrors in the village in order to make a garden. There is a beautiful young girl who comes in front of the teacher and makes some hand movements.

One villager is digging for a treasure for 50 years but finds nothing and dies. Suddenly a boat appears in the desert and the police arrives to investigate the sudden disappearance of the teacher.

Its not a linear story line but quite a fable mixing up Arabian culture, mysticism, folklore, legend with some stunning desert visuals and hauntingly melodious Tunisian music. Without the credits, it is difficult to know the characters, but the young kid is quite a devil in the movie.

Nacer Khemir manages to captivate the audience with the never ending suspense. Viewers are trying to piece together the various scenes in order to make a context out of the story. IMDB 4/10

Kalikallam


 Action packed Malayalam movie “Kalikkalam” (1990) directed by Sathyan Anthikad and starring Mammootty, Murali, Shobana, Sreenivasan among others.

Its a classic robinhood story as Mammootty is a robber who robs from the rich and corrupt and spends that money for the poor & disadvantaged. He assumes various roles and identities to dupe the police as well.

Murali is a new police officer and honest one at that. Its a cat and mouse between Murali and Mammootty and try as he might, no clues lead the police to the robber.

One too many murders take place and Murali being a suspended police officer on the spot is arrested and tried for murder. Mammootty is moved by that prospect of an innocent police inspector going to jail and makes amends towards that end.

There are many other character actors in the movie including Shobana who is reduced to a side role as somebody who is pining for the robber. Innocent, Mamukoya, Shankarady, Sreenivasan, Sukumari, Philomena all play useful little roles in their inimitable manner.

This is more action oriented than the earlier movies of Sathyan Anthikad. There is an underlying subtext to the movie in the form of subtle messaging towards corrupt persons and innocent guys getting caught instead. Fine acting by Murali — he was such a fantastic actor in the Malayalam cinema. IMDB 5/10

Bim

 Award winning Trinidad and Tobago film “Bim” (1974) directed by Hugh. A. Robertson and starring Ralph Maraj, Anna Seerattan, Wilbur Holder, Lawrence Goldstraw among others.

Its a kind of a political drama movie of the Indians settled in Trinidad and Tobago. They are nearing their independence from the British empire and Bim (Ralph Maraj) is their natural born leader, though his past is that of a hoodlum doing all sorts of bad things.

Bim’s early age was in an upheaval, becuase his father was killed right in front of him by another Indian rival. He is rejected by his school and taunted and bullied by the afro students. He has no choice but to take to crime to live his life.

Bim’s early love life Anna (Anna Seerattan) later takes to prostitution and he discovers Anna while at one of his sexual flings. Bim gravitates towards political leadership in order to take revenge upon the killers of his father.

While the political climate is hotting up, Bim continues to be arrogant and rejects the offer of a political alliance with the leader of the blacks in Trinidad. The print uploaded on youtube is of a poor quality and overall production values are very poor.

But this movie is supposed to be a cult classic in Trinidad which is why i think somebody should digitally enhance this movie to latest standards. The plot is decent and the story conveys what is intended. IMDB 3/10
